Output 61c28eeaedcb89d9cd34dacdfdca6a11c20fe4e18c57ec8f360b704b2a4d1839:1

value
17286000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c64411b169d46b70d256d40f6cc017101acc8731 OP_EQUAL
address
3KmMG3v7T4Uye8VbDRMmmMHsUH392riNQ1
transaction
61c28eeaedcb89d9cd34dacdfdca6a11c20fe4e18c57ec8f360b704b2a4d1839
spent
true